About Mount Colah 2079

The size of Mount Colah is approximately 11.4 square kilometres. It has 21 parks covering nearly 89.7% of total area. The population of Mount Colah in 2011 was 7,104 people. By 2016 the population was 7,098 showing a population decline of 0.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mount Colah is 50-59 years. Households in Mount Colah are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mount Colah work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 84.6% of the homes in Mount Colah were owner-occupied compared with 85.1% in 2016.

Mount Colah has 3,096 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Mount Colah have seen a 64.56%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 8.03%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Mount Colah is $1,629,293 while the median value for Units is $670,660.
  • Houses have a median rent of $800 while Units have a median rent of $570.
